## Data Stores — Contrast Audit (Lintbird)

Quick note for support: the color-contrast audit results from the Lintbird crawler land in their own store, separate from the main app database. Each row has the page, element selector, measured ratio, and pass/fail against our AA threshold. If a customer asks why a page was flagged, look it up there first. Read-only access goes through the connection string below.

replica DSN, kajep-yahag: mssql://praok_svc:iF@db-8d68.plorvaio.local:5432/eliion

Plugin authors should note that boost factors for title, body, and tag fields differ per environment; sandbox intentionally exaggerates title boosts so ranking changes are easier to observe. Synonym expansion and stemming behave identically everywhere, but decay curves for recency are flattened in staging. Always validate your plugin against the staging weights before requesting production review. The current staging relevance configuration is as follows.

deployment values, yadug-bawif:
[framir]
team = pelox
access_code = ac_a38ab2
owner = tamion.julael
host = framir.tolvaqlabs.test
port = 11211
peer = tammir.zemvargrid.local
salt = 2215ef03
pin = 1541

QUARTERLY PLANNING NOTE — FINANCE TEAM

Subject: Wind-down of the Avenlow fixture line

The Avenlow fixture line will be retired over the next two quarters. Finance should model the write-down of remaining inventory (roughly 4,100 units at the Corbinvale warehouse), reclassify tooling assets, and flag any supplier break fees from the Merrow contract. Revenue forecasts should exclude Avenlow from Q4 onward. Draft figures are due before the planning review on the 28th. The strategic rationale appears in the note below.

management briefing: Gross margin on Holath came in at 20 percent against a plan of 10 percent. Only 9 of the 100 pilot accounts renewed Holath, so a churn review is set for January 15.